Главная  /  Журнал  /  Как бесплатно использовать нейросети для программирования

Как бесплатно использовать популярные нейросети для программирования через GitHub Copilot в 2025 году

Как бесплатно использовать нейросети для программирования

В мире современной разработки программного обеспечения искусственный интеллект становится незаменимым помощником. «Вайбкодинг» - программирование с помощью нейросетей - набирает популярность среди разработчиков всех уровней. Одним из самых мощных инструментов на рынке является GitHub Copilot, который можно использовать бесплатно при определенных условиях.

Что такое GitHub Copilot

GitHub Copilot- это ИИ-инструмент, разработанный GitHub в сотрудничестве с Open AI, который интегрируется непосредственно в среду разработки, например VisualStudio Code. Он анализирует ваш код и контекст, предлагая релевантные дополнения кода и помогая решать программистские задачи.

В основе Copilot лежат передовые языковые модели, включая такие модели как GPT-4.1 и GPT-4o-mini с контекстным окном в 256K токенов, что позволяет анализировать и генерировать большие объемы кода.

Почему стоит использовать GitHub Copilot:

  • Экономия времени разработчика.
  • Снижение количества рутинных операций.
  • Помощь в изучении новых языков программирования.
  • Доступ к передовым нейросетям без дополнительных затрат.

Что такое Вайбкодинг

Вайб кодинг (Vibe сoding) - это современный подход к программированию, который становится все более популярным в среде разработчиков. Суть вайб кодинга заключается в использовании нейросетей для написания кода вместо традиционного ручного программирования.

Основные характеристики вайб кодинга

Принцип работы:

  • Программист описывает на естественном языке, что должен делать код.
  • ИИ-ассистент (например, GitHub Copilot, основанный на моделях GPT) генерирует соответствующий код.
  • Разработчик корректирует, принимает или отклоняет предложения ИИ.

Ключевые особенности:

  • Значительное ускорение процесса разработки.
  • Снижение количества рутинных операций.
  • Возможность сосредоточиться на архитектуре и логике приложения, а не на синтаксисе.
  • Доступность программирования для людей с меньшим опытом кодирования.

Термин «вайб кодинг» происходит от слияния слов «вайб» (атмосфера, настроение) и «кодинг» (программирование), что подчеркивает более плавный, интуитивный процесс создания кода без погружения в детали синтаксиса языков программирования.

Современные инструменты для вайбкодинга используют продвинутые языковые модели, такие как GPT-4.1, GPT-o3, GPT-o4-mini с контекстными окнами до 256K токенов, что позволяет им анализировать и генерировать значительные объемы кода.

Влияние на индустрию

Вайбкодинг меняет подход к обучению программированию и к самому процессу разработки, делая его более доступным и менее техническим на начальных этапах. Это особенно важно для новичков и для быстрого прототипирования.

Однако важно понимать, что эффективное применение вайбкодинга все равно требует от разработчика понимания принципов программирования и способности оценить качество сгенерированного кода.

Наш Телеграмм-канал

Пошаговая инструкция по настройке бесплатного доступа к GitHub Copilot

Шаг 1: Скачивание и установка VisualStudioCode

Для начала необходимо скачать и установить редактор кода VisualStudioCode, если он еще не установлен на вашем компьютере. Это бесплатная среда разработки, которая отлично работает с GitHubCopilot.

Шаг 2: Установка необходимых расширений

После установки VSCode необходимо добавить два ключевых расширения:

  • GitHub Copilot
  • GitHub Copilot Chat

Это можно сделать через вкладку Extensions в боковой панели VSCode (или нажав Ctrl+Shift+X), а затем введя названия этих расширений в поисковую строку.

Шаг 3: Регистрация аккаунта на GitHub

Если у вас еще нет аккаунта на GitHub, необходимо зарегистрироваться на официальном сайте. Базовая регистрация бесплатна и открывает доступ к множеству полезных функций для разработчиков.

Шаг 4: Подключение GitHub к VSCode и активация Copilot

После установки расширений и создания аккаунта:

  1. Откройте VSCode.
  2. Войдите в аккаунт GitHub через опцию авторизации.
  3. Активируйте GitHub Copilot через расширение.

Для студентов, преподавателей или участников определенных программ GitHub может быть доступно бесплатное использование Copilot.

Шаг 5: Начало использования

Для использования Copilot:

  1. Откройте или создайте файл с кодом
  2. Нажмите CTRL+I для вызова Copilot Chat
  3. Введите запрос на генерацию кода или помощь
  4. Принимайте предложения кода с помощью клавиши Tab

Работа с нейросетями через GitHub Copilot

GitHub Copilot позволяет взаимодействовать с различными языковыми моделями. По имеющимся данным, в Copilot могут использоваться различные версии GPT, включая GPT-4.1 и GPT-4o-mini.

Возможности современных моделей в GitHub Copilot:

  • GPT-4.1: Расширенный контекст и улучшенное понимание кода.
  • GPT-4o-mini: Может работать с контекстным окном до 256K, что особенно полезно для анализа больших файлов кода.

Ограничения бесплатного использования

Важно отметить, что бесплатное использование GitHubCopilot имеет определенные ограничения. Хотя точные лимиты могут меняться со временем, сейчас они таковы:

  • Количество ответов ограничено 2000 дополнениями код.
  • 50 сообщений в чате в месяц.

Использование API-ключей

Для более продвинутых пользователей может быть интересна возможность подключения дополнительных нейросетей через API-ключи. Данная функция бесплатна и доступна всем пользователем.

Заключение

Бесплатный доступ к нейросетям через GitHub Copilot открывает впечатляющие возможности как для начинающих, так и для опытных разработчиков. В 2025 году искусственный интеллект становится неотъемлемой частью процесса программирования, и GitHubCopilot представляет собой один из самых доступных способов начать использовать эти технологии без финансовых затрат.

Попробуйте настроить GitHub Copilot по предложенной инструкции, и вы сможете ощутить, как современные нейросети могут значительно ускорить процесс разработки и открыть новые горизонты в программировании.